    First Day of School:

    **The first day of school will be an exciting time for all of us! The school doors will open at 8:35 a.m. where your children can walk directly to our classroom. I will be at the classroom door to greet each child. School faculty will be greeting our bus riders as they exit the buses and walk down the halls.  It's normal for some students to feel apprehensive and nervous to come in, but please know that even if there are a few tears they quickly dissipate as soon as the day really starts. In the days leading up to the start of school, you can prepare your child by having conversations.  Ask them what are they looking forward to learning, talk about your positive school experiences, etc....
